Newest results Boy diving in … Web12. nov 2024 · There are two main ways that humans can breathe underwater: using a rebreather or using an underwater breathing apparatus (UBA). A rebreather is a device that recycles the air that a person exhales, allowing them to breathe it in again. This means that a person can stay underwater for a much longer time, as they are not constantly using up …
